- method ng_status: ng_status
- method set_ng_status: ng_status -> 'self
+ method ng_mode: [`ProofMode | `CommandMode]
+ method set_ng_mode: [`ProofMode | `CommandMode] -> 'self
+ (* Warning: #stack and #obj are meaningful iff #ng_mode is `ProofMode *)
+ inherit NTacStatus.tac_status
(** list is not reversed, head command will be the first emitted *)
val add_moo_content: GrafiteMarshal.ast_command list -> status -> status
(** list is not reversed, head command will be the first emitted *)
val add_moo_content: GrafiteMarshal.ast_command list -> status -> status
val get_current_proof: status -> ProofEngineTypes.proof
val get_proof_metasenv: status -> Cic.metasenv
val get_stack: status -> Continuationals.Stack.t
val get_proof_context : status -> int -> Cic.context
val get_proof_conclusion : status -> int -> Cic.term
val get_current_proof: status -> ProofEngineTypes.proof
val get_proof_metasenv: status -> Cic.metasenv
val get_stack: status -> Continuationals.Stack.t
val get_proof_context : status -> int -> Cic.context
val get_proof_conclusion : status -> int -> Cic.term
val set_stack: Continuationals.Stack.t -> status -> status
val set_metasenv: Cic.metasenv -> status -> status
val set_stack: Continuationals.Stack.t -> status -> status
val set_metasenv: Cic.metasenv -> status -> status